Prompting is not about art, it is about ontology

Most people think prompts are about style. That is the shallow reading. The deeper truth is that prompts are about ontology, the question of what something is allowed to become.

A subject rendered as a flat icon is not the same subject rendered as a vintage photo. A city seen through a fisheye lens is not the same city seen from a satellite. A portrait in double exposure does not merely look different. It implies a different relationship between self and environment, figure and context, memory and identity. The prompt does not decorate reality. It chooses the mode of being through which reality is experienced.

That is why the best prompt patterns feel less like instructions and more like philosophical operators:

  • Isometric says, make the object readable as a system.
  • Knolling says, make the parts visible as a collection.
  • Cutaway diagram says, make the hidden interior knowable.
  • Exploded view says, show the relations by separating the components.
  • Double exposure says, let two truths coexist in one frame.
  • Tilt-shift says, turn the world into a model of itself.

Each one changes not only appearance but interpretation. A child coloring page invites participation rather than passive viewing. Naïve art reintroduces wonder by simulating innocence. A satellite photo enlarges the scale of cognition, making the human scene feel municipal, logistical, or planetary. These are not just visual styles. They are cognitive lenses.

And that is the insight we need to carry into every increasingly intelligent interface, including financial ones. The interface is not neutral. If prompting teaches us how systems see, then wallets teach us how systems act on our behalf. The more abstract the interface becomes, the more important its ontology becomes. What seems like a simplification is also a claim about the world.

A practical framework: the four layers of editable reality

To make this useful, think about digital systems through four layers:

1. The asset layer

This is the thing itself: a token, an image, a file, a payment, a message.

2. The action layer

This is what the system lets you do with it: buy, sell, transform, export, remix, verify.

3. The frame layer

This is the lens that governs interpretation: icon, satellite photo, isometric map, vintage photo, cutaway, double exposure.

4. The intent layer

This is what the user actually wants: ownership, expression, clarity, persuasion, play, discovery.

Most products optimize only the asset layer and the action layer. The most powerful products, and the most magical prompts, operate on the frame layer in service of intent. They reduce the mismatch between what you mean and what the system can do.

This framework explains why some tools feel empowering and others feel brittle. If a wallet lets you buy crypto but makes the process feel opaque, the action layer exists without the frame layer supporting trust. If an image model can create beautiful outputs but cannot reliably honor your intended frame, the frame layer is rich but unstable. The sweet spot is when the system aligns all four layers so cleanly that the user feels not just assisted, but understood.

That is the future experience frontier: intent fulfillment through editable frames.
